Trend Curves vs. Trend Graphs

What's the Difference?

Trend curves and trend graphs are both tools used to visually represent data trends over time. However, trend curves typically show a smooth, continuous line that connects data points, while trend graphs display data points as individual markers connected by lines. Trend curves are often used to show overall trends and patterns, while trend graphs are useful for highlighting specific data points or fluctuations. Both tools are valuable for analyzing and interpreting data trends, but the choice between using a trend curve or trend graph depends on the specific data being presented and the desired level of detail.

Definition

A trend curve is a smooth line that represents the general direction in which data points are moving over time. It is often used to show long-term trends and can help identify patterns or cycles in the data. On the other hand, a trend graph is a visual representation of data points plotted on a graph, typically with time on the x-axis and the variable of interest on the y-axis. Trend graphs can show both short-term fluctuations and long-term trends in the data.

Accuracy

One key difference between trend curves and trend graphs is the level of accuracy they provide. Trend curves are often smoother and more generalized, which can make them easier to interpret for overall trends. However, this smoothing can also lead to a loss of detail, making it harder to identify specific data points or outliers. On the other hand, trend graphs show each individual data point, providing a more detailed and accurate representation of the data. This can be useful for analyzing short-term fluctuations or identifying specific data points of interest.

Interpretation

When it comes to interpreting data trends, trend curves and trend graphs can offer different insights. Trend curves are useful for identifying overall patterns and trends in the data, such as whether the data is increasing, decreasing, or remaining stable over time. They can help simplify complex data sets and make it easier to understand the general direction of the data. On the other hand, trend graphs allow for a more detailed analysis of the data, showing how individual data points contribute to the overall trend. This can be useful for identifying specific points of interest or understanding the variability in the data.

Visualization

Another important aspect to consider when comparing trend curves and trend graphs is their visualization. Trend curves are often smoother and more visually appealing, making them easier to interpret at a glance. They can help highlight the overall trend in the data and make it easier to see patterns or cycles. On the other hand, trend graphs can be more cluttered and harder to interpret, especially when there are a large number of data points. However, trend graphs provide a more detailed view of the data, allowing for a closer analysis of individual data points.

Application

When deciding whether to use a trend curve or a trend graph, it is important to consider the specific application and goals of the analysis. Trend curves are often used when the focus is on identifying general trends or patterns in the data. They can help simplify complex data sets and provide a clear visual representation of the overall direction of the data. On the other hand, trend graphs are more suitable for analyzing individual data points and understanding the variability in the data. They can be useful for identifying outliers, analyzing short-term fluctuations, or comparing different data sets.
